Antoninus Pius, 138-161. Sestertius (Orichalcum, 32mm, 27.03g 11), Rome, c. 146. ANTONINVS AVG PIVS P P TR P Laureate head of Antoninus Pius to right. Rev. COS IIII / S C Pius standing in quadriga moving slowly to left, he stretches out his right hand and holds an eagle-tipped scepter in his left. BMC 1670. Cohen 320. RIC 767a. With a superb portrait and an attractive, dark olive green-brown patina. Extremely fine.
